WebBruised heel taping is intended to compress the soft tissues around the affected heel. This increases the natural cushioning of the foot which then protects the heel from further trauma and thus encourage healing. To do that, you will need a roll of zinc oxide tape of between 1 and 2.5 cm width. This special event is perfect for you if you experience any of the following symptoms: bit direct incA bruised heel, also known as a Policeman’s Heel or a fat pad contusion, is a contusion of the tissues and bone under the heel. The heel bone is protected by a layer of fatty tissue composed of elastic fibrous tissue septa, which separates closely packed fat cells.
